Rutherford B. Hayes's Cabinet

President: Rutherford B. Hayes (1877-1881)

Vice President: William A. Wheeler (1877-1881)

Secretary of State: William M. Evarts (1877-1881)

Secretary of the Treasury: John Sherman (1877-1881)

Secretary of War: George W. McCrary (1877-1879), Alexander Ramsey (1879-1881)

Attorney General: Charles Devens (1877-1881)

Postmaster General: David M. Key (1877-1880), Horace Maynard (1880-1881)

Secretary of the Navy: Richard W. Thompson (1877-1880)

Colorado becomes a state during this election cycle. One of most controversial elections ever; Electoral Commission awarded it to Hayes. One of only 5 elections (18241876188820002016) where the popular vote winner was defeated.
